As I researched Black Potatoes: The Story of the Great Irish Famine, 1845-1850, the question that haunted me first was, Who are the heroes of the Famine? Are the heroes the political leaders, public servants, individuals, and charitable groups who worked hard to provide relief for the starving Irish but who could not prevent a huge loss of life? Or are there stories of agency, activism, and heroism among the suffering Irish people themselves?
